May 1,2002 draft C:\WINDOWS\TEMPORARY INTERNET FILES\OLK21C2\BLDGFACD.DOC

LICENSE AGREEMENT This License Agreement made this day of 2002 by and between the CITY OF NEW YORK (hereinafter called "the City"/Licensee), acting by and through the Department of Environmental Protection of the City of New York (hereinafter called "DEP”), with an ofSce at 59-17 Junction Boulevard, Corona, New York 11368-5107 and

("Landowner/Licensor")

the owner of the premises at

(the “Premises”).

WHEREAS, the facades, roofs and setbacks (“exterior areas”) of many structures in close proximity to the site of the former World Trade Center have been found to contain debris, refuse and other deposits (“the foreign material”) of unknown origin;

WHEREAS, the owners of said structures are desirous of having the foreign material removed;

WHEREAS, the City believes that it is in the interest of the public to undertake a clean up of these exterior areas;

WHEREAS, the City’s willingness to undertake such a cleanup should not in any way be construed as an acknowledgment or admission that the City is any way responsible for any condition, environmental or otherwise, that may exist in or on the exterior areas or that the foreign material is a risk to the public health or safety;

NOW THEREFORE, it is hereby agreed by and between the parties to this agreement, for and in consideration of One Dollar and other good and valuable consideration, the receipt of which is hereby acknowledged.

1. Permission to Perform Cleaning Work. Subject to the terms and conditions hereof, Licensor hereby grants permission to Licensee and its authorized contractor(s) to perform the cleaning work on the exterior areas of the structure(s) located on the Premises, as described in the Scope of Work attached hereto as Exhibit A and made a part hereof (the “Cleaning Work”).
